Study on Structure-Rheology Relationships in Multiphase Polymeric Systems

Abstract: Structure-rheology relationships have been studied on polymer blends, block copolymers and polymer composites. The excess shear stress of polymer blends with droplet/matrix structure after application of a large step shear strain is predicted fairly well by the Doi-Ohta theory, when the interface tensor describing the anisotropy of the interface can be evaluated from observation of the deformed interface shape.
